    2000 rear end in a 95

    Has any one put a 2000 (98 or later I would guess) rear end into a 95 (93 to 97) Camaro? Neither 2000 rear or the car have traction control. I wanted to know how much trouble it was and what modifictions need to be done. Thanks

    The ABS setup will be a bit different, and the brakes are a different style (parking brake is a drum-in-hat setup, as opposed to cable operated caliper). From a hard parts standpoint, the trailing arms, driveshaft, and panhard bar will all mount up exactly the same.
